*Obituary
Edith Lorene (Wilson) passed away Sunday April 5, 2015 at Caprock Nursing and Rehabilitation Center in Borger.

She was born February 28, 1931 in Binger Oklahoma to Ollie B. and Maggie (Ruminer) Wilson. She moved to Borger from Fairfax Oklahoma in 1955.

She was a self-employed upholster. She was a member of St. Andrew United Methodist Church of Borger. Edith loved to travel.

She was preceded in death by her parents, a sister Norma Brown and a brother Billie Wilson.

She is survived by her husband Douglas Wayne Hooks of Borger; a son Bryan Arthur and wife Kianah Sissel of Albuquerque New Mexico; 5 step-daughters: Wilma Lanell and Bill Reynolds of Borger, Patricia and husband Robert Wells of Borger, Dona Faye and husband Tony Elrod of Borger, Deena Gray of Borger and Vickie Henslee of Fritch; a sister Betty Grig of Fairfax Oklahoma ; a brother Doc and wife Ruth Wilson of Ponca City Oklahoma; 10 grandchildren; 14 great grandchildren and 1 great-great granddaughter.
